Transaction 28841696df71ba7ca8d459521468fed10e2a43e7a34147d4d63535084237e2fb

1 Input
1 Outputs
  • 28841696df71ba7ca8d459521468fed10e2a43e7a34147d4d63535084237e2fb:0
  • value  740847
    address  1EqgauJHzhb9HjNiqg89qD2N4VmDCN42ra